Krepšelis (0) Uždaryti

Krepšelyje nėra produktų.

Krepšelis (0) Uždaryti

Krepšelyje nėra produktų.

Home Форекс Брокеры Yahoo Finance API A Complete Guide
TEST

Yahoo Finance API A Complete Guide

yahoo india finance my portfolio

Morningstar was founded on providing high-quality investment research to everyone, not just financial professionals. The company seeks to empower investor success and for its users to achieve financial security. You do not need to show any interest in their advisory services to use their free tools. Additionally, Empower also offers educational resources and retirement planning guides to help ensure you’re prepared for the future. Nate is a serial entrepreneur, part-time investor, and founder of WallStreetZen.

It is also very easy to setup and use, but again like yfinance lacks market analysis/news- though it offers a good range a good range of fundamentals and options data. It also aids in understanding market patterns and whether or not the movement of a security is due to the actual company performance or if it is a tangential impact from overall market or sector news. Using a tracking tool, like Yahoo! Finance, is probably the easiest way to monitor portfolios, especially if an investor has more than one portfolio (such as a 401(k) and a personal investment account). Tracking portfolio holdings is an integral part of investing in securities. Even buy and hold long-term investors need to follow the news and trends that affect both investment securities and the whole market.

Predictive Modeling w/ Python

In the absence of a date being passed (ticker only), the functions will return the earliest upcoming expiration date’s data. Get_quote_table() doesn’t do this by default but takes an optional dict_result parameter that when set to False also makes the method return a pandas data-frame (instead of a dictionary). This setup is particularly useful in combination with some of Yahoo_fin’s other methods if we want to quickly gather data for all the certain markets. Overall, RapidAPI is a bit fiddlier to use and get started with, but if you want to make a lot of requests or have access to more detailed data and don’t mind a bit of extra work, it could be a good bet. You will have to sign up for an account, and deal with API keys when making requests so RapidAPI is not quite as easy to get started with and utilise as some of the other options.

yahoo india finance my portfolio

Schwab Intelligent Portfolios Solutions also invests in third-party ETFs. Schwab receives compensation from some of those ETFs for providing shareholder services, and also from market centers where ETF trade orders are routed for execution. Fees and expenses will lower performance, and investors should consider all program requirements and costs before investing.

In particular the free open source libraries have a medium risk of some components not working at some point in the future, even if historically problems have eventually been fixed. This makes the Yahoo Finance API perfect if you’re a relative beginner and just want to dive in and get your feet wet instead of spending hours puzzling over complex documentation. We will discuss the pros and cons of several of the unofficial APIs/libraries that now exist to access this data, and then go through how to use one of them in detail. For those who prefer Excel over Google Sheets, I suggest first loading the data with the add-on into Google Sheets and then downloading XLSX from Google Sheets, as shown in the video. If so, you are likely familiar with the problem of pulling high-quality, up-to-date data into a spreadsheet.

Seeking Alpha: The Best Stock Portfolio Tracker Overall

And to use, where you just create a ticker object with a ticker symbol, and then simple method calls on the object return absolutely everything you could want to know. Alternatively, you can pay a little extra dollar for one of the official finance data API alternatives like Quandl, Alpha Vantage or IEX where you can be sure your data won’t just be randomly cut-off one day. Again because the libraries and unofficial APIs sometimes scrape data, they could get rate limited or blacklisted by Yahoo Finance at any time (for making too many scrapes).

  • And if you’re ready to perform some fundamental analysis on one of your stocks or want to know what the top-performing analysts on Wall Street have to say about it, you’re just one click away.
  • The app makes dollar-cost averaging the default which, combined with its design, makes investing for the long haul easy.
  • There is no advisory fee or commissions charged for Schwab Intelligent Portfolios.
  • An official reason was never given but it is widely thought to be an issue with large scale misuse of data because so many people were using it to build personal applications (there was no requirement to be logged into Yahoo or anything!).
  • Service charges apply for trades placed through a broker ($25) or by automated phone ($5).

In the below, you’ll see that over their distinct holding periods, 6 of the 8 positions outperformed the S&P. The last two, Twitter (which actually has had a negative return) and Walmart underperformed an equal timed investment in the S&P 500. Coming down on a technical level, the process of obtaining a historical stock price is a bit longer than the case of yfinance but that is mostly due to the huge volume of data. Now we move onto some of the important functions of yahoofinancials. The second method is to use the yahoofinancials module which is a bit tougher to work with but it provides much more information than yfinance.

Practical Guides to Machine Learning

In the past, I downloaded historical price data from Yahoo Finance and used INDEX and MATCH functions in excel to calculate the relative holding period performance of each position versus the S&P 500. While this is an OK way to accomplish this goal, conducting the same using pandas in Jupyter notebook is more scalable and extensible. Whenever you download new data and load into excel, you inevitably need to modify some formulas and validate for errors.

Countries repatriating gold in wake of sanctions against Russia – study – Yahoo Finance

Countries repatriating gold in wake of sanctions against Russia – study.

Posted: Sun, 09 Jul 2023 07:00:00 GMT [source]

Options trades will be subject to the standard $0.65 per-contract fee. Service charges apply for trades placed through a broker ($25) or by automated phone ($5). See the Charles Schwab Pricing Guide for Individual Investors for full fee and commission schedules.

One thought on “Download Financial Dataset Using Yahoo Finance in Python A Complete Guide”

For example, create a portfolio called New Portfolio, that consists of three stocks-GE, IBM, and Disney. Here users can sync up to investment accounts at over 80 brokers and new portfolios are created. Yahoo! Finance provides help with all the functions related to setting up and tracking a portfolio on their own site, but below we provide a quick guide on how to use the tool. Schwab Intelligent Portfolios® and Schwab Intelligent Portfolios Premium® are made available through Charles Schwab & Co.

  • We will discuss that later and now we will begin by importing the required modules into our code.
  • As such, solutions attempting to gather data from Yahoo Finance use a mixture of direct API calls, HTML data scraping and pandas table scraping depending on the function and library/API in question.
  • Charles Schwab Investment Management, Inc. (CSIM) is the investment advisor for Schwab Funds and Schwab ETFs.
  • Its commitment to its users is obvious in all of its products.

While we can get access to an impressive range of data, the Yahoo Finance API sometimes lacks the bells and whistles of more specialised APIs. I recently learned a few ways how the Yahoo Finance data is used for analysis and I would like to share them in the article, since the article gained a lot of attention. Residents, Charles Schwab Hong Kong clients, Charles Schwab U.K. Please read the Schwab Intelligent Portfolios Solutions™ disclosure brochures for important information, pricing, and disclosures related to the Schwab Intelligent Portfolios and Schwab Intelligent Portfolios Premium programs. If your TD Ameritrade account is moving to Schwab soon, or has already moved, create your Schwab Login ID and password. While Morningstar offers many of its services for free, a subscription to Morningstar Premium unlocks some of its most useful features.

As a quick background, I have been investing in my own stock portfolio since 2002 and developed a financial model for my portfolio a number of years ago. One view / report which I’ve never found from online brokers and services is a “Public Market Equivalent”-like analysis. In short, the Public Market Equivalent (PME) is a set of analyses used in the private equity industry to compare the performance of a private equity fund relative to an industry benchmark. You can also dynamically monitor your trailing stops, based on your own trading rules. And you have created visualizations which allow you to have much better insight into your master dataframe, focusing on the different metrics and each position’s contribution to each.

In this API roundup, you’ll find the top stock market APIs developers most commonly use on the Rapid API Hub to get real-time stock quotes, data feeds, and stock exchanges. There are no monthly account service fees, you’ll earn interest on your balance, yahoo india finance my portfolio and your account is FDIC-insured8 up to $250,000. You’ll receive free standard checks once your account is funded with at least $100, and Schwab Bank Bill Pay™ will be activated and a Visa® Platinum Debit Card will be sent upon account opening.

Sign up to get daily digests on the stocks that matter to you.

You have taken the individual dataframes for the S&P 500 and individual stocks, and you are beginning to develop a ‘master’ dataframe which we’ll use for calculations, visualizations and any further analysis. Next, you continue to build on this ‘master’ dataframe with further use of pandas merge function. Below, you reset the current dataframe’s index and begin joining your smaller dataframes with the master one.

yahoo india finance my portfolio

Each of these allow you to quickly view the performance of your entire portfolio, take a closer look at individual positions, have research integrated into the investment software, and allow you to perform more in-depth stock analysis. Now you have a relatively extensible Jupyter notebook and portfolio dataset, which you are able to use to evaluate your stock portfolio, as well as add in new metrics and visualizations as you see fit. You will begin by importing the necessary Python libraries, import the Plotly offline module, and read in our sample portfolio dataframe. Apart from the yf.download function, we can also use the ticker module and you can execute the below code to download the last 5year stock prices of Apple. That said, the range of data available is the most extensive of the options we’ve found- with RapidAPI you can get fundamentals and options data as well as market news and analysis- the latter two are not available with our other options. Some of the offerings include market data on Cryptocurrencies, regular currencies, stocks and bonds, fundamental and options data, and market analysis and news.

Related Post

Parašykite komentarą

El. pašto adresas nebus skelbiamas. Būtini laukeliai pažymėti *